Roulette is a sophisticated and iconic casino game that represents the ultimate intersection of chance, physics, and human hope. At its core, the word refers to a game played on a table that features a large, horizontally spinning wheel. This wheel is divided into numbered compartments, or pockets, which are colored either red or black, with one or two green pockets representing the house edge. The game begins when a croupier, or dealer, spins the wheel in one direction and launches a small white ball in the opposite direction along a tilted circular track. As the ball loses momentum, it eventually falls into the wheel and settles into one of the thirty-seven or thirty-eight numbered pockets. The primary objective for players is to predict where that ball will land, placing bets on a corresponding felt table layout before the dealer announces that no more bets are allowed. This game is a staple of gambling culture worldwide, from the high-stakes rooms of Monte Carlo to the neon-lit floors of Las Vegas.

Beyond the physical game, the term has evolved into a powerful metaphor for any situation involving high risk, unpredictability, or a complete lack of control over the outcome. When someone says they are 'playing roulette' with their career or their health, they are suggesting that they are taking a dangerous gamble where the results are left entirely to fate. This metaphorical usage is common in political commentary, financial analysis, and personal storytelling. It evokes a sense of tension and the potential for either a significant win or a devastating loss. The word carries a certain weight, suggesting that the stakes are high and the person involved is at the mercy of external forces. It is this duality—the specific game and the broader concept of chance—that makes 'roulette' such a versatile and evocative noun in the English language.

Despite its relative simplicity, 'roulette' is a word that often trips up English learners and even native speakers in several ways. The most frequent error is spelling. Because the word is of French origin, its spelling does not follow standard English phonetic rules. People often forget the double 't' at the end or misplace the 'ou' and 'e.' Common misspellings include 'rulette,' 'roulete,' or 'roulett.' It is important to remember the 'ou' at the beginning and the 'ette' suffix, which is a common French diminutive meaning 'small.' Another common mistake involves pronunciation. The stress should be on the second syllable (roo-LET), but some speakers mistakenly place the stress on the first syllable (ROO-let), which can sound awkward or make the word harder to recognize.

Confusing with 'Rule'
Because the first four letters are 'roul,' some beginners confuse it with words related to 'rules' or 'rulers.' It is vital to distinguish that 'roulette' is strictly about the wheel and the game, not about regulations.

Incorrect: He played rulette all night. Correct: He played roulette all night.

Another conceptual mistake is using 'roulette' to describe any game of chance. While it is a game of chance, it is not a synonym for 'gambling' or 'poker.' You wouldn't say 'I'm playing roulette with these cards.' Roulette specifically requires a wheel and a ball. Furthermore, when using the term 'Russian roulette,' people sometimes use it lightly to describe minor risks. However, given the lethal nature of the actual 'game' it refers to, using it for trivial matters (like 'I'm playing Russian roulette with this expired milk') can sometimes be seen as insensitive or overly dramatic depending on the audience. It's best to use 'roulette' or 'a gamble' for minor risks and reserve 'Russian roulette' for truly dire or life-threatening metaphors.

Roulette vs. Blackjack
While both are casino games, Blackjack involves cards and a degree of skill/strategy (counting cards), whereas Roulette is almost entirely based on physical probability and luck.
Roulette vs. Poker
Poker is a game played against other players where psychological bluffing is key. Roulette is played against the 'house' (the casino) and involves no interaction with other players' hands.

أصل الكلمة

The word 'roulette' is borrowed directly from French. It first appeared in the late 17th or early 18th century. It is the diminutive form of the French word 'roue,' which means 'wheel.'

المعنى الأصلي: The original meaning in French was simply 'little wheel.' It was applied to various small mechanical wheels before becoming the name of the specific gambling game.

It belongs to the Indo-European family, specifically the Romance branch via French, originating from the Latin word 'rota' (wheel).

Yes, roulette is considered a pure game of chance. While players can choose different betting strategies, the physical outcome of where the ball lands is random and cannot be influenced by the player's skill.

The main difference is the number of pockets. European roulette has 37 pockets (numbers 1-36 and one zero), while American roulette has 38 pockets (1-36, a zero, and a double zero). This makes the odds slightly better for players in the European version.

The name comes from the French word for 'little wheel.' It was named after the central device used in the game, which is a small, horizontally spinning wheel.

Russian roulette is a dangerous and often lethal game of chance where a person places a single bullet in a revolver, spins the cylinder, and pulls the trigger. Metaphorically, it refers to taking an extreme and potentially fatal risk.

Yes, it is possible to win money in the short term if you are lucky. However, because of the 'house edge' (the green zero pockets), the casino statistically wins more money than it pays out over a long period of time.

A croupier is the professional casino employee who operates the roulette table. They spin the wheel, launch the ball, announce the winning number, and manage the bets and payouts.

The most common bets are 'outside bets' like Red or Black, Odd or Even, and High or Low numbers. These have a nearly 50% chance of winning and pay out 1 to 1.

Reputable online casinos use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ure that the results of their digital roulette games are as random and fair as a physical wheel.

The house edge is the mathematical advantage the casino has over the players. In European roulette, it is about 2.7%, and in American roulette, it is about 5.26%.

The Martingale is a famous betting strategy where a player doubles their bet after every loss, hoping that the first win will recover all previous losses plus a small profit. It is very risky because of table limits and the potential for a long losing streak.
